Synopsis

This new book is aimed at non-specialist students of business law on a variety of courses in colleges and universities. The book is written in a simple and approachable style and provides regular opportunities for student self-assessment throughout the book in the form of quizzes and questions with answers.
Opportunity for further assessment is provided by the inclusion of assignments and problems in the text, with answers available separately in an Instructor's Manual.
This book is written in response to the need for a shorter, more accessible law text which is student centred. The subject coverage of the book has been designed to follow the 'core' topics which appear most frequently on syllabuses and examination papers. It is also written to encourage an interest in business law. It stresses the fact that law operates in the context of society and affects students on a daily basis.
Cases chosen are accessible and constant cross-referencing indicates the interrelationship of different areas of the law. As well as explaining legal principles, the book also provides assistance with study skills.

Quatrième de couverture

The fourth edition of this successful textbook is written specifically for readers who are new to the study of law in the context of business.  It has a lively style, and provides regular opportunities for student self-assessment throughout the book in the form of quizzes and examination style questions. The subject coverage of the book has been designed to follow the core topics which appear most frequently on syllabuses and examination papers. It is also written to encourage a genuine interest in the subject of business law, stressing the fact that the law operates in the context of society and affects people on a daily basis. 

Features of the book:

* Covers a wide range of topics in business law satisfying most syllabuses

* Up to date coverage of the most recent legislation and key case histories

* Easy to read colour text, avoiding legal jargon where possible

* Includes a good range of short and more-challenging questions, making the book suitable for varied ability levels

* Self-assessment encouraged throughout, with quizzes and assignments on each subject

* Section on study and examinations skills helps readers know how to apply their knowledge when it counts

* Companion Website: www.pearsoned.co.uk/adams containing a downloadable instructor's manual with diagrams for lecture presentations and further solutions to exercises

This new edition has been thoroughly updated and revised in the following areas:

*Further expansion of Contract and Tort Law, and discusses The Law Commissions 2005 Report on Unfair Terms in Contracts

*Covers developments in employment law including the impact of The Disability Discrimination Act 1995 [Amendment] Regulations 2003, the implementation of The Employment Equality (Sexual Orientation) Regulations 2003 and the Employment Equality (Religion or Belief] Regulations 2003, the Equality Bill 2005 and the Commission for Equality and Human Rights.

*Includes over 70 new cases

This text will be suitable for: non-specialist students of business law on a variety of courses, from undergraduate degree programmes to professional courses in business and accountancy.

Alix Adams has over thirty years' experience of teaching law from GCSE to degree and postgraduate level and is a qualified Barrister.  She is a Principal  Lecturer in Law  and a director of Law Tutors Online www.lawtutorsonline.co.uk.
